For measurements inside the FlexRay node (with "Source type" = "Logic"), each line
requires its threshold level.
There are two ways to set the thresholds: selection of a predefined value, or direct entry
of a value.
"Preset"
Selects default threshold voltages from a list. The predefined values depend on the
selected source type. The value is set to "Manual" if at least one threshold was
entered directly.
"Threshold high" and "Threshold low"
Upper and lower levels for single-ended or differential source types. You can enter
the values directly in the fields.
"Threshold data" and "Threshold enable"
Levels for data and enable line in case of logic source type. You can enter the values
directly in the fields.

Polarity
Selects the wire on which the bus signal is measured in case of "Single-ended" mea-
surement: "Bus plus" or "Bus minus". The setting affects the digitization of the signal.
